Nasdaq rises to record, Dow bats eyes at 20,000
The Dow Jones industrial average ended just 25 points shy of 20,000, a level it has never breached, helped by a 1.68 percent gain in Goldman Sachs . U.S. stocks have been on a tear since the Nov. 8 presidential election, with the Dow up 9 percent and the S&P 500 gaining 6 percent on bets that Trump's plans for deregulation and infrastructure spending will boost the economy. Some investors believe stocks have become expensive.
